Summary

A viral TikTok video shows a rabbit's displeased reaction when a second rabbit joins its household. The video has gained millions of views and likes, showcasing the rabbit's stomping behavior as a sign of protest. Despite initial protests, the rabbit eventually grows accustomed to its new companions.

Key Facts

  • A TikTok video featuring a rabbit's reaction to a new housemate has gained 2.3 million views.
  • The video was posted by the account @lolo.luca.lily and shows the rabbit stomping, which is its way of expressing displeasure.
  • Users commented on the video, noting the rabbit's dramatic 'double stomping' behavior.
  • Rabbits are not very common pets in the U.S., with about 1 million households owning them.
  • Experts suggest that rabbits are social animals and often need companionship.
  • Initially, the rabbit did not like the new addition, but it eventually accepted its new companions.
  • American Veterinary Medical Association data indicates that rabbits are present in about 0.7% of U.S. homes.
